Not on findmypast
'''Note that some India Office Records will not be found in the findmypast database''', (for technical or other reasons) but may be found on [[IGI|FamilySearch]], as transcribed index records and digitised microfilms. Examples are some/all of the records from Madras: Baptisms, Marriages, Burials ‎ (Oct 1815-May 1818) IOR/N/2/6 [[IGI|FamilySearch]] microfilm 506957, and Madras: Roman Catholic Returns of Baptisms, Marriages and Burials ‎ (1838-1839) IOR/N/2/RC/1-2 [[IGI|FamilySearch]] microfilm 530008<ref>Glover, Jill. [https://lists.rootsweb.ancestry.com/hyperkitty/list/india@rootsweb.com/thread/220935/ KENNEDY/HILL Saga – Disappointment] ''Rootsweb India List'' 8 December 2015. Retrieved 1 July 2018.</ref> . Note that names may be '''transcribed incorrectly''' which will affect the findmypast Search. If you cannot find a record you are looking for, cross check with records on Familysearch, or try a more general search on findmypast. See "11 tips for searching", External links below.
For privacy reasons be aware that currently (2018) a limited transcription only is available with no digital images for births after 1917, and for marriages after 1932. These dates have been increased since the original restrictions in place when the databases were introduced in 2014 (which were after 1914/1929), but not on an annual basis, so possibly this will happen every three years. Expanded details of these restricted records can be obtained from the British Library, or from FamilySearch microfilm/digitised microfilm, see [[FamilySearch Centres]].
==Other records==
**This category also contains electoral registers which may be useful if you are tracing a person who has returned or immigrated to the UK. The main database is "England & Wales, Electoral Registers 1832-1932", although there are gaps in the records for various years, and not all constituencies are included (ongoing project). These records are displayed as pdf documents. There is also the associated dataset "England & Wales, Electoral Registers 1832-1932 Image Browse". Read the findmypast Search tips. There are also electoral registers on Ancestry.
*findmypast category "Newspapers, Directories & Social History/Directories & Almanacs", "British In India, Directories 1792-1948 Browse",<ref>[https://search.findmypast.co.uk/search-world-Records/british-in-india-directories-1792-1948-browse British In India, Directories 1792-1948 Browse] findmypast.</ref> introduced 2018/05/18. Of the titles examined as a sample, all were freely available elsewhere, (and in fact may be the same digital files), see the Fibiwiki pages [[Directories online]], [[Newspapers and journals online]] and [[Indian Army List online]]. Additionally, it is necessary to use the search, (or browse) to find the exact years of publication available. These publications are '''not''' currently searchable by name. The findmypast viewer for this database is slow, and it would be quicker to view a volume elsewhere.
 
==Ancestry database==
*"UK, Registers of Employees of the East India Company and the India Office, 1746-1939". Located in Schools, Directories & Church Histories, available from 15 February 2018.<ref>[https://search.ancestry.co.uk/search/db.aspx?dbid=61468 UK, Registers of Employees of the East India Company and the India Office, 1746-1939] Ancestry database</ref> Data from The Wohl Library of the Institute of Historical Research, School of Advanced Study, University of London. The data is searchable, and the Directories and similar publications may be browsed from a link on the right hand side of the webpage "Browse this collection". Includes some pre 1800 publications. Includes many publications not available online elsewhere.
